A small birdcage is held in her left hand, seemingly empty, while her right arm points upwards towards a parrot perched on the top edge of the wall. This detail introduces an element of whimsical absurdity. The parrots presence and the woman’s gesture create a narrative ambiguity; she appears to be either directing attention or playfully scolding the bird.
The background is rendered in shades of pink, creating a warm and somewhat dreamlike atmosphere. It lacks specific details, focusing instead on color and form to enhance the figure’s prominence. The composition directs the viewers gaze from the woman’s face down her body and then upwards towards the parrot, reinforcing the playful dynamic between them.
Subtly, the work explores themes of captivity and freedom. The empty birdcage might symbolize a desire for liberation or perhaps a commentary on the constraints placed upon women during the period in which this was created. The parrot, often associated with mimicry and exoticism, could represent an untamed spirit or a longing for something beyond the confines of domesticity. Ultimately, the painting presents a carefully constructed image that blends sensuality, humor, and a touch of underlying complexity.
